SmallRig Unveils Dynamic Imaging Solutions at NAB Show 2026
At the NAB Show 2026,
SmallRig made waves by showcasing various innovative imaging solutions tailored for specific production scenarios. The highlights included a sophisticated off-road vehicle-mounted multi-camera setup, engineered to meet the demands of dynamic outdoor environments. This cutting-edge system is equipped with multiple action cameras, enabling multi-angle captures while ensuring stability even in challenging settings, thus demonstrating quick deployment capabilities in field productions.
A Multifaceted Approach to Production
SmallRig's booth was meticulously designed around practical production scenarios that reflect the essence of modern filmmaking. By creating areas dedicated to outdoor filmmaking, multi-camera workflows, and mobile content creation, the company effectively integrated its equipment into real-world applications. Visitors to the booth had the unique opportunity to engage with solutions that mirrored their individual creative processes.
The booth featured six distinct zones:
Off-Road Vehicle,
Camera Cart,
Tripod,
DreamRig Customization,
Battery & Lighting, and
Creator Service Station. Each area highlighted diverse content creation scenarios, showcasing equipment that ranged from professional filmmaking gear to solutions for vlogging and live streaming. Notable items included DJI's
Osmo Pocket 4 ecosystem accessories, the RF 20C Portable LED Video Light, and the TRIBEX Monopod—each designed to enhance creativity and efficiency in production.

Enhancing Creator Experience
In an innovative move, SmallRig introduced a
Creator Service Station within its booth. This station offered on-the-spot services such as device charging, gear lending, and hands-on demonstrations of products. The initiative fostered direct interaction with creators, enabling SmallRig to gather valuable feedback to better address user needs and guide future product development.
This focus on user experience is part of SmallRig's broader strategy of co-creation, which emphasizes collaboration between users and designers. The company's DreamRig customization program and industry partnerships further reinforce this approach, allowing for feedback-driven product improvement.
Collaborative Efforts for Product Development
Currently, SmallRig has collaborated with over 1,700 creators worldwide, leading to the development of more than 2,700 co-created products. This extensive network is supported by a responsive supply chain that accelerates both product development and deployment, ensuring a steady stream of innovative solutions tailored to evolving industry needs.

SmallRig's Legacy
Founded in 2013, SmallRig has grown into a prominent global provider of imaging solutions, offering an extensive ecosystem that includes camera accessories, lighting, power supplies, and audio products. Initially focused on camera mounting, the brand has evolved into a versatile platform that supports creators across more than 160 countries.
